A study found that the average four year old laughs four hundred times a day.  The average adult in the happiest of countries laugh sixteen times a day.  Why do children laugh?  They live in the present moment without cares and guilt, feeling loved, finding newness in all they behold.  Children live with a freedom – a freedom that fades with each passing year.  A child says what he/she feels, speaking from the heart.  A child is true to his/her own inner nature.  Life moves from within to without.
